Exploring Onsite Sewage Disposal System Examples

When it comes to proper wastewater management, onsite sewage disposal systems play a critical role in ensuring that households and small communities can safely and efficiently dispose of their sewage These systems are designed to treat and dispose of wastewater on the same property where it is generated

There are various types of onsite sewage disposal systems, each with its own unique features and benefits Let’s explore some examples of these systems to better understand how they work and their importance in wastewater management.

1 Septic Tank Systems

One of the most common onsite sewage disposal systems is the septic tank system This system consists of a large underground tank that collects wastewater from the household The solids settle at the bottom of the tank, while the liquids flow out through a series of pipes into a drain field The drain field allows the liquid waste to be absorbed into the soil, where it is naturally filtered and treated.

Septic tank systems are relatively simple and cost-effective to install and maintain However, they require regular pumping and inspection to ensure that they are functioning properly Failure to maintain a septic tank system can lead to costly repairs and potential health hazards.

2 Aerobic Treatment Units

Aerobic treatment units (ATUs) are advanced onsite sewage disposal systems that use oxygen to break down and treat wastewater These systems are ideal for properties with limited space or poor soil conditions ATUs are compact and can be installed above or below ground.

While ATUs are more expensive to install than septic tanks, they offer superior treatment capabilities and require less maintenance over time.

3 Mound Systems

Mound systems are another type of onsite sewage disposal system that is commonly used in areas with high water tables or shallow bedrock These systems involve the construction of an elevated mound made of sand, gravel, and soil on which the drain field is placed.

Mound systems are designed to provide additional treatment and filtration of wastewater before it is discharged into the soil The mound acts as a barrier to prevent contamination of groundwater and surface water sources Mound systems are effective at treating wastewater in challenging environments but are more costly and labor-intensive to install and maintain.

4 Constructed Wetlands

Constructed wetlands are innovative onsite sewage disposal systems that mimic the natural treatment processes of wetlands These systems use plants, soil, and microorganisms to filter and treat wastewater before it is discharged into the environment Constructed wetlands are ideal for properties with ample space and suitable soil conditions.

Constructed wetlands are highly effective at removing pollutants and nutrients from wastewater, making them a sustainable and eco-friendly option for onsite sewage disposal These systems also provide habitat for wildlife and enhance the aesthetic value of the property While constructed wetlands require periodic maintenance, they offer long-term benefits in terms of water quality and environmental conservation.
